Cypress Oil

Cypress oil is an essential oil with a fresh and woody aroma, obtained from the leaves and branches of the cypress tree (Cupressus sempervirens) through the steam distillation method. With its anti-inflammatory, antiseptic, and astringent properties, it offers numerous benefits ranging from skin care to respiratory health.

Usage Suggestions:

  • Aromatherapy: You can use cypress oil in a diffuser or an oil burner to balance the mood and provide relaxation. It opens up the airways and ensures mental peace.
  • Skin Care: Apply cypress oil to the skin by diluting it with a carrier oil (such as jojoba oil or coconut oil). For acne, pimples, and skin problems, it can be applied directly to the affected areas. It is recommended to test on a small area of the skin before use.
  • Massage Oil: To relieve muscle pain, improve circulation, and reduce the appearance of cellulite, you can practice a massage by blending cypress oil with a carrier oil. It can be utilized especially for the legs and problematic zones.
  • Steam Inhalation: To soothe the airways, you can practice steam inhalation by adding a few drops of cypress oil to hot water.
  • Natural Deodorant: With its sweat-reducing and odor-eliminating properties, cypress oil can be used as a natural deodorant. It can be applied to the underarms in spray form by adding it to water, or by diluting it with a carrier oil.
